Apartment with a total area of ​​210 sq.m.

The main distinctive feature of this project can be called its non-standard architecture. Here are combined radius and angular shapes, second light in the living room area, attic floor, beams, low and high ceilings. All these moments add complexity to the design, but at the same time make the object unique in its kind.

In the center of the living room is a large sofa, to the right of it is an open storage system from Poliform. The main lighting is provided by stretch strings with spotlights and an accent pendant lamp by Davide Groppi. It will fill the space with a cozy, diffused light. The kitchen is located in a separate room, and it also has access to a laundry room. The private area is separated from the common area by a door to the right of the entrance to the apartment. The master bedroom, children's room, and wardrobe can be accessed from the corridor directly behind it. There is also a staircase that leads to the second floor, which serves as a family lounge area.

The apartment already had some elements that the customers asked to be kept. These included the staircase, the tiles in the hallway and kitchen, and the window sills. Therefore, the color scheme was created based on these inputs.
